Actions to Obtain a Driver's License
Figure out Eligibility
- Age Requirements: Most nations have minimum age requirements for obtaining a driver's license. In the United States, for instance, the minimum age is typically 16 for a student's license and 18 for a complete license. Nevertheless, these can differ by state.
- Residency Requirements: Applicants must typically be locals of the state or nation where they are obtaining the license.
- Legal Status: In many places, candidates need to be legal locals or people.
Take a Written Test
- Research study the Driver's Manual: Before taking the written test, it is necessary to familiarize yourself with the driver's manual, which contains guidelines of the road, traffic indications, and safe driving practices.
- Practice Tests: Many states and countries use practice tests online to help you prepare for the genuine exam.
- Test Day: On the test day, bring all needed files, such as evidence of identity, residency, and date of birth. The test typically consists of multiple-choice concerns.
Use for a Learner's Permit
- Files Required: Typically, you will need to provide evidence of identity, residency, and date of birth. Some locations likewise require proof of enrollment in a driver's education course.
- Fees: There is typically a cost for the student's license, which can differ by area.
- Restrictions: A learner's authorization typically features constraints, such as driving just with a certified adult over a certain age in the front seat or not driving throughout certain hours.
Complete Driver's Education
- Classroom Instruction: Most states require a specific variety of hours of classroom direction, which covers subjects such as traffic laws, safe driving practices, and the mechanics of driving.
- Behind-the-Wheel Training: In addition to classroom direction, lots of places need a specific number of hours of behind-the-wheel training with a certified instructor.
Log Driving Hours
- Supervised Driving: With a learner's authorization, you will require to log a certain variety of monitored driving hours. The needed number of hours can vary by state, however it is generally between 50 and 100 hours.
- Logging Hours: Keep a log of your driving hours, including the date, time, and conditions of each drive. Some states require this log to be signed by a parent or guardian.
Take a Driving Test
- Scheduling the Test: Once you have actually completed the needed driving hours, you can schedule your driving test. This is normally done through the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V) or a similar government firm.
- Test Preparation: Practice driving in different conditions to guarantee you are well-prepared for the test. Some states provide practice tests or test information on their websites.
- Test Day: On the test day, bring your student's permit, evidence of completion of driver's education, and any other needed files. The test will examine your capability to safely run an automobile, follow traffic laws, and manage various driving situations.
Pass a Vision Test
- Vision Screening: Most driving tests include a vision screening to ensure that you satisfy the minimum vision requirements for driving.
- Corrective Lenses: If you require restorative lenses to fulfill the vision requirements, you will need to use them throughout the test and while driving.
Spend for the License
- Fees: There is generally a charge for the driver's license, which can differ by state or country. This fee covers the expense of processing your application and releasing the license.
- Payment Methods: Fees can normally be paid by cash, charge card, debit card, or check.
Get Your Driver's License
- Short-lived License: Immediately after passing the driving test, you will get a temporary driver's license. This is normally a piece of paper that stands for a short period, such as 30 to 60 days.
- Permanent License: Your irreversible driver's license will be mailed to you within a couple of weeks. It is essential to check that all the details on the license is correct.
Common Requirements for a Driver's License
- Evidence of Identity: A valid government-issued ID, such as a passport or birth certificate.
- Proof of Residency: An energy bill, lease contract, or other main document that shows your present address.
- Evidence of Date of Birth: A birth certificate or passport.
- Social Security Number (SSN): In the United States, you may require to provide a Social Security number.
- Completion of Driver's Education: Proof that you have actually completed the required number of hours of class and behind-the-wheel training.
- Driving Log: A log of your monitored driving hours, signed by a moms and dad or guardian if needed.
- Passing Scores on Written and Driving Tests: You must attain the needed passing score on both the written and driving tests.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q: Can I obtain a driver's license if I am under 18?
- A: In numerous states, you can acquire a student's license at 16 and a complete license at 18. Nevertheless, some states have actually finished licensing programs that allow younger motorists to get a restricted license with additional requirements, such as supervised driving hours and a curfew.
Q: What files do I need to give the DMV?
- A: You will generally need to bring:
- Proof of identity (e.g., passport, birth certificate)
- Proof of residency (e.g., energy costs, lease contract)
- Proof of date of birth (e.g., birth certificate)
- Social Security number (if relevant)
- Completed driver's education course (if required)
- Driving log (if needed)
Q: How long does it take to get a driver's license?
- A: The process can differ depending on your place and the number of driving hours needed. Usually, it can take a number of months from the time you start studying the driver's handbook to the time you receive your long-term license.
Q: What if I fail the driving test?
- A: If you fail the driving test, you can generally retake it after a quick waiting duration, which differs by location. It is a good idea to practice more and recognize locations where you require enhancement before retaking the test.
Q: Can I utilize a driver's license from another state or country in my new state?
- A: In the United States, most states have a reciprocity arrangement that allows you to move your driver's license from another state if you move. However, you will require to satisfy the new state's requirements, which may include taking a vision test or a written test. If you are moving from another nation, you may need to take both the written and driving tests to acquire a license in your new state.
Q: Is there a distinction in between a student's authorization and a provisional license?
- A: Yes, a learner's license enables you to drive just under supervision, while a provisional license (or intermediate license) permits you to drive independently with particular restrictions, such as a curfew or limitations on the number of passengers.
Q: What happens if I am captured driving without a license?
- A: Driving without a license is illegal and can lead to fines, license suspension, or even arrest. If you are captured, you may also need to pay additional charges and complete additional training to acquire your license.
Q: Can I get a driver's license if I have an impairment?
- A: Yes, lots of states and countries offer unique accommodations for people with disabilities.
